Ancient and very noble Catalan family ascribed to the Spanish nobility for many centuries propagated in Italy in the 16th century. The ancestral nobility of the Bandera family is confirmed by the presence of the blazon in the state archives of Spain. Another family. Ancient and noble Emilian family called Banderi or Bandera raised for weapon: Golden, to the three rippled bands of blue, the central loaded with a field lily. Alias. Golden, with the three bands rippled in black, the power plant loaded with a field lily; with the triangulated border of gold and black. ...

1. Coat of arms of family: Bandera
Language of the text: Español
En sinople, cinco estrellas, de oro, puestas en aspa.
Fuente bibliográfica: "Repertorio de blasones de la comunidad hispánica - letras A-B-C-CH Vicente De Cadenas y Vicent Instituto Salazar y Castro" pàgina 249.
D'oro, alle tre fasce increspate d'azzurro, la centrale caricata di un giglio del campo.
Blasone della famiglia Banderi ricostruito da un disegno conservato presso la Biblioteca estense universitaria nell'opera "Insegne di varii prencipi et case illustri d'Italia e altre provincie" don Jacomo Fontana, AD 1605. Note: si trova anche la forma Bandera.
D'oro, alle tre fasce increspate di nero, la centrale caricata di un giglio del campo; colla bordura triangolata d'oro e di nero.
Blasone della famiglia Banderi ricostruito da un disegno conservato presso la Biblioteca estense universitaria nell'opera "Araldo, nel quale si vedono delineate e colorite le armi de' potentati e sovrani d'Europa, delle più cospicue d'Italia ...," del frate minore osservante Angelo Maria da Bologna. Note: si trova anche la forma Bandera.
